49ers RB Jeff Wilson suffers torn meniscus, will miss start of the season

By David Bonilla
May 25, 2021

San Francisco 49ers running back Jeff Wilson Jr. will miss the start of the 2021 season. Mike Garafolo of NFL Network reports that the player recently underwent surgery to repair a torn meniscus, and is expected to miss four to six months as he recovers. #49ers RB Jeff Wilson...
